CMA CGM is set to move into the last-mile e-commerce delivery sector, agreeing to acquire a 51% stake in French B2C distribution specialist Colis Privé from its own Hopps Group for an undisclosed amount.
The French carrier said the agreement also included the option of increasing its stake in the future, and the acquisition is clearly part of its strategy to build an end-to-end logistics provider, with obvious synergies with logistics subsidiary Ceva.
